Subject: DR Drill Recap — ProfileShard Split

Team,

Ahead of Thursday's eng sync: the disaster-recovery drill for the Nimblecore user-profile store went mostly to plan. We resharded profiles across four replicas, replayed the write log, and verified checksums within the 40-minute target. One gap: the restore runner stalled because nobody on-call had the vault passphrase handy. We've since rotated it and agreed it belongs in the drill doc itself. For the record, the current recovery passphrase is:

strongbox words: zordor-quenax

Subject: Flaky DNS resolution — Quillhaven staging

Team,

Intermittent resolution failures hitting the Quillhaven staging resolvers since last night. Roughly 3% of lookups time out, retries succeed. Suspect the new caching layer in the Bramblenet sidecar; rolled it back on two nodes and failures stopped there. No evidence of poisoning or tampering — failure mode is timeout, not bad answers. Security review requested before we re-enable. Full packet captures attached to the incident doc. Reference token for the affected build follows.

pipeline stamp: htk3_cc5

## Ownership

The clock-skew monitor for the Quarrylight build farm lives in this repo. Build agents occasionally drift more than the 250ms tolerance, which breaks artifact timestamp ordering and causes the Slatebird scheduler to mark runs as flaky. If support sees skew alerts, first check the NTP sidecar logs, then escalate rather than restarting agents manually — restarts mask the drift without fixing it. Questions about the monitor, its thresholds, or the escalation path go to the component owner listed below.

account owner for kagag-yahap: Novath Quenok